Thomas Marshall

Birth1655 - Westmoreland, Virginia, United States
Death31 May 1704 - Westmoreland, Virginia, United States
MotherNot Available
FatherJohn Marshall

Born in Westmoreland, Virginia, United States on 1655 to John Marshall. Thomas Marshall married Martha Sherwood and had 6 children. He passed away on 31 May 1704 in Westmoreland, Virginia, United States.
